Minnesota Twins third base coach Gene Glynn talks to Mike Berardino about growing up as a three-sport athlete in Waseca, his influences throughout his career and how to survive the minor leagues.
Mike Berardino is joined by longtime baseball scout Kimball Crossley, who spent the last 15 years with the Toronto Blue Jays. He talks about his desire to meld analytics with traditional scouting, how he got into the business as a journalism major who never played varsity baseball and how he's put his theatre background to use while working in professional baseball.
Mike Berardino is joined by Wayne "Big Fella" Hattaway, who has spent 66 years in baseball -- 55 of them with the Minnesota Twins organization. He talks about his love for Alabama football and the Cowboys, tells stories about past and present Twins players and explains how he got ejected from games at multiple levels of baseball.
